DedeCMS(织梦内容管理系统)是一款流行的PHP开源网站管理系统。在DedeCMS中,SQL语句嵌套是指在一个SQL查询中嵌入另一个SQL查询,以实现更复杂的数据检索和处理。
假设我们有一个DedeCMS网站,需要查询某个分类下的所有文章,并且这些文章的发布时间在特定日期之后。
<?php
// 假设我们有一个分类ID为10,发布时间在2023-01-01之后的文章
$catid = 10;
$start_date = '2023-01-01';
$sql = "SELECT * FROM `dede_archives` WHERE `typeid` = (SELECT `id` FROM `dede_arctype` WHERE `id` = $catid) AND `pubdate` > '$start_date'";
$result = $dsql->ExecuteNoneQuery($sql);
while ($row = $dsql->GetArray($result)) {
// 处理每一行数据
echo $row['title'] . '<br>';
}
?>
通过以上信息,您可以更好地理解DedeCMS中SQL语句嵌套的基础概念、优势、类型、应用场景以及可能遇到的问题和解决方法。
领取专属 10元无门槛券
手把手带您无忧上云